  • the invention relates to a lock for vehicle seat belts, with a load-bearing housing and a trigger button slidably guided therein, which is biased by a spring force into a rest position and has an actuating surface.
  • the lock For use in seat belt systems that are equipped with a belt tensioner that engages the lock, the lock must be secured against unintentional opening at the end of the tensioning process.
  • the belt tensioner shifts the lock towards the vehicle floor until a stop is reached.
  • the stop When the stop is reached, the movement of the lock is suddenly braked.
  • the inertia due to the inertia, its functional parts endeavor to continue their movement. This also applies to the release button, the inertial movement of which would cause the lock to open.
  • the invention has for its object to provide a lock for vehicle seat belts, which is secured against unintentional opening and does not differ from conventional lock designs in terms of design principle, design and size.

  • the actuation surface is pressed in the usual way, which, in contrast to the conventional lock design, is not formed on the release button, but rather on the push button integrated therein.
  • the push button By depressing the push button, the two-armed lever is first pivoted until its second lever arm is pivoted out of the area of the stop part of the lock housing. Only then is the trigger button moved by further depressing the pushbutton until it finally releases the latch in a conventional manner, which holds the tongue in the lock.
  • the two-armed lever simultaneously tries to perform a pivoting movement in such a way that its second lever arm is opposite the stop part of the Lock housing remains.
  • the further movement of the release button is prevented by the second lever arm striking the stop part of the lock housing.
  • the release button is made in two parts by leaving out the area of the actuating surface and a separate pushbutton being slidably mounted in the recessed area; furthermore, the two-armed lever is pivotally mounted on a pin inside the release button.
  • the changes therefore essentially only affect the release button, a component which is molded from plastic and can therefore easily be replaced by another.
  • a lock for vehicle seat belts consists of a load-bearing housing, functional parts mounted thereon and a plastic cover shell surrounding these elements, which gives the lock the shape shown in FIG. 1.
  • the actuating surface of a release button 12 is located on the end face of the cover shell 10.
  • a pushbutton 14 protrudes by 2 to 3 mm from this actuating surface of the release button 12.
  • the release button 12 has a recess 16, in which the Push button 14 is guided.
  • the push button 14 is generally cap-shaped, with two flanges 14a, 14b at its longitudinal ends, which come to rest on the inside of the release button 12.
  • a bracket 18 Part of the conventionally designed and therefore not described load-bearing housing of the lock is a bracket 18, the end face of which is opposite the push button 14.
  • a two-armed angled blocking lever 20 is pivotally mounted on a pin 22.
  • the first lever arm 20a engages in the cavity of the push button 14 and rests with its free end on the inside of the push button.
  • the second lever arm 20b lies opposite the end face of the bracket 18 forming a stop part and is loaded by a compression spring 24 supported on the release button 12 in such a way that the first lever arm 20a is held in contact with the inside of the pushbutton 14.
  • the center of gravity S of the blocking lever 20 lies in the second lever arm 20b on the outside of a plane running through the axis of the bearing pin 22 and parallel to the longitudinal direction of the lock.
  • the release button 12 is preloaded into the rest position shown in FIG. 2 by a normal return spring, not shown in the drawing.
  • the push button 14 is first depressed.
  • the two-armed blocking lever 20 is pivoted clockwise in FIG. 2, whereby its second lever arm 20b is moved next to the end face of the bracket 18. Only now can the release button 12 be depressed via the push button 14 in order to open the lock.

Claims (5)

1. Boucle pour ceintures de sécurité pour véhicules, comprenant un boîtier (10) qui supporte la charge et une touche de déclenchement (12) guidée mobile dans ce dernier, soumise à la charge initiale d'une force de ressort qui la retient en position de repos et comportant une surface d 'actionnement, caractérisée en ce que la surface d'actionnement de la touche de déclenchement (12) est formée sur un poussoir (14) qui est intégré à la touche de déclenchement (12) et qui est guidé mobile dans cette dernière sur une course limitée dans la direction de la mobilité de la touche de déclenchement (12) et qui est soumis à la charge initiale d'une force de ressort (24) qui le retient en position de repos, en ce qu'un premier bras (20a) d'un levier de blocage (20) à deux bras monté pivotant sur la touche de déclenchement (12) prend appui contre le poussoir (14), tandis que son second bras (20b) est en face d'un élément de butée (18) du boîtier supportant la charge lorsque le poussoir (14) est en position de repos et ce levier pivote en s'écartant de l'élément de butée. (18) lorsque le poussoir (14) est enfoncé par rapport à la touche de déclenchement (12) et en étant librement déplaçable de manière à passer à côté de l'élément de butée (18) dans la même direction de déplacement-que celle de la touche de déclenchement (12) et en même temps que celleci, en ce que la force de ressort qui soumet le levier de blocage (20) à la charge initiale le maintenant en position de repos est plus faible que la force de ressort qui soumet la touche de déclenchement (12) à une charge initiale la retenant en position de repos et en ce que le centre de gravité (S) du levier de blocage (20) se trouve sur le côté extérieur d'un plan parallèle à la direction de la longueur de la bouche et passant par l'axe de pivotement du levier de blocage (20).
2. Bouche selon la revendication 1, caractérisée en ce que, lorsque le poussoir (14) est en position de repos, sa surface d'actionnement est saillante à l'extérieur de la touche de déclenchement (12).
3. Bouche selon la revendication 1 ou 2, caractérisée en ce que le poussoir (14) comprend au moins un rebord (14a, 14b) qui, lorsqu'il est en position de repos, est appliqué contre le côté intérieur du bord du trou (16) de la touche de déclenchement (12) dans lequel le poussoir (14) est logé mobile.
4. Bouche selon l'une des revendications précédentes, caractérisée en ce que le second bras (20b) du levier de blocage (20) prend appui contre la touche de déclenchement (12) par l'intermédiaire d'un ressort de compression (24).
5. Bouche selon l'une des revendications 2 à 4, caractérisée en ce que la surface de poussée du poussoir (14) est au moins approximativement à fleur de la surface extérieure de la touche de déchenchement (12) lorsqu'il est en position enfoncée par rapport à cette dernière.
